

Fisher Bottoms is a lowland stretch near Ririe along the river and irrigated fields—great for wide-open landscape shots, river reflections, migrating waterfowl and cottonwood-lined channels. Best at sunrise or sunset for warm side light and dramatic skies. Access is by rural roads; park at pullouts and avoid private fields. Expect seasonal water levels and bird activity (spring/fall peak).
